WebOct 11, 2024 · Any profit you earn selling an investment could be subject to what is called the capital gains tax. So if you buy a stock for $20 and sell it for $25, you have $5 in capital gains that will be taxed. Capital gains are taxed at different rates depending on how long you held the investment, also known as short-term and long-term rates. If you buy ... WebJul 8, 2024 · Cryptocurrency taxes. The idea behind the concept is to make trades over short … lake street apartments south lyon miFor those entirely new to financial markets, the basic distinction in tax structure is between long- and short term investments. Long-term investments, those held for more than a year, are taxed at a lower rate than trades held for less than a year, which are taxed at the normal income rate. You can see a full … See more Traders must report gains and losses on form 8949 and Schedule D. You can deduct only $3,000 in net capital losses each year. However, if you’re married and use separate filingstatus then it’s $1,500. Traders must provide … See more The most drastic difference of TTS designation is the ability todeduct losses beyond the $3,000 allowed as capital losses. TTS … See more You might qualify for Trader Tax Status (TTS)if you trade 30 hours or more out of a week and average more than 4 or 5 intraday trades per day for the better part of the tax year.
